Open to remote in several markets for highly qualified candidate. This Senior Auditor-Audit Analytics position supports Audit Analytics team. This role is responsible for supporting and assisting in the development of the Internal Audit data analytics program, supporting the execution of internal audit work by leveraging data analytics, and creating process efficiencies. These responsibilities will include:
- Support data analytic effort in supporting internal audit programs, including developing scope, planning, execution, and reporting.
- Work with the audit team in identifying new opportunities of leveraging data analytics in audit projects.
- Effectively communicate with business owners on data analysis results and be a strong representative of the Internal Audit department.
- Provide data analytic documentation according to the internal audit documentation standards.
The Senior Auditor should demonstrate a strong understanding of data analytics and associated technologies to support the audit plan and program. This individual will be responsible for utilizing data analysis techniques to provide insights and efficiency to the internal audit projects including analyzing enterprise data to meet audit objectives, creating tools to automate audit processes and procedures, supporting ad-hoc data analytics needs, and assisting in the development of the Internal Audit Data Analytic Program.
